Title: Innovations of Mitsugu Enomoto

Introduction

Mitsugu Enomoto is a notable inventor based in Higashikurume, Japan. He has made significant contributions to the field of engineering, particularly in the development of advanced materials and processes. With a total of three patents to his name, Enomoto's work reflects a commitment to innovation and practical applications in technology.

Latest Patents

One of Enomoto's latest patents is a wear-resistant reed for a high-speed loom. This invention features a diamond-like carbon (DLC) film formed on a portion of a reed blade, which is essential for high wear resistance in high-speed looms. The design incorporates stainless steel as the base material, with a titanium carbide layer serving as an intermediate layer. This innovative approach ensures that reed blades coated with a DLC film are strategically placed at the sides of the reed, where wear occurs most rapidly. Additionally, the central portion of the reed can utilize either lower-cost hard films or non-coated blades, promoting uniform wear across the entire reed. This reed is versatile and suitable for various types of fibers, including natural, synthetic, and new material fibers.

Another significant patent by Enomoto is a method of sensing the amount of a thin film deposited during an ion plating process. This method involves either fixing the voltage applied to a plasma-generating probe and measuring the current flowing through it or fixing the current and measuring the voltage developed at the probe. The measurements obtained can be utilized to control the thickness of the deposited thin film to a desired value, enhancing precision in manufacturing processes.
